rohu2007
Goto Top

Batch für das Tool CSVSplitter

Hallo Zusammen,

ich benötige eure Hilfe, ist für jemanden vielleicht ein Klaks, aber ich habe keinen Plan davon.
Ich möchte gerne das Tool CSVSplitter von www.lueftenegger.at mit einer Batch ausführen.

Leider weiß ich nicht mal wie ich den Aufruf aus der CMD machen kann. Habe bisher nur mit ganz einfachen Batch Dateien zutun gehabt.

Diese Parameter sind angegeben:

Konsolenparameter:

Flag                        required default description
--------------------------------------------------------------------------------
-i | --inputFile            ja               Quelldatei
-l | --lineNumber                    10000   Teile nach Zeilen.
-s | --sourceHeader                  False   Quelle enthält Spaltenüberschriften
-t | --targetHeader                  False   Schreibt Spaltenüberschriften in
                                             Zieldateien.
                                             !Ignoriert fals -s nicht definiert.
-c | --sourceTextDelimiter           "       Textbegrenzer in Quelle.  
-m | --sourceLineDelimiter           \r\n    Zeilenumbruch in Quelle.
-f | --sourceFieldDelimiter          ;       Spaltentrenner in Quelle.
-n | --targetTextDelimiter           -t      Textbegrenzer in Zieldatei.
-o | --targetLineDelimiter           -m      Zeilenumbruch in Zieldatei.
-p | --targetFieldDelimiter          -f      Spaltentrenner in Zieldatei.
-j | --indices:[i|h]                         i - Spalten sind mittels 
                                                 Spaltennummer definiert..
                                             h - Spalten sind mittels
                                                 Spaltenüberschriften definiert.
-e | --exportHeader                          Spalten, sie in Zieldatei 
                                             geschrieben werden sollen
                                             [csv - data].
-b | --splitBefore                           Ein String, der die Teilungs-
                                             kriterien enthält. Die Quelldatei 
                                             wird VOR der Zeile getrennt, die 
                                             den Kriterien entspricht.
-a | --splitAfter                            Ein String, der die Teilungs-
                                             kriterien enthält. Die Quelldatei
                                             wird NACH der Zeile getrennt, die
                                             den Kriterien entspricht.
                                             !Ignoriert falls -b definiert.

Für eure Hilfe bin ich euch dankbar!

Content-Key: 379384

Url: https://administrator.de/contentid/379384

Printed on: April 24, 2024 at 07:04 o'clock

Member: vossi31
vossi31 Jul 06, 2018 at 07:56:08 (UTC)
Goto Top
Moin,

haben du und DanielG80 die gleiche Aufgabe bekommen?
Batch zum Auslesen einer .txt Datei in Variablen

Dein Kollege hat aber wenigstens noch ein Frage formuliert?

Henning
Member: rohu2007
rohu2007 Jul 06, 2018 at 08:45:56 (UTC)
Goto Top
nein, ich habe nichts mit dem anderen User zutun.
bei mir liegt das Problem ganz wo anders!!!
Member: erikro
erikro Jul 06, 2018 at 09:53:53 (UTC)
Goto Top
Moin,

und was ist das Problem?

Liebe Grüße

Erik
Mitglied: 136588
136588 Jul 06, 2018 updated at 11:37:38 (UTC)
Goto Top
Zitat von @erikro:
und was ist das Problem?
Vermutlich der Freitag, Gehirn meets weekend face-wink.

Ohne deine Textdatei zu kennen, können wir dir hier mit der richtigen Parameterwahl nicht helfen, schon klar oder ?? ... Die Parameter sind doch eigentlich sehr anschaulich beschrieben, wenn man also deine uns unbekannte Textdatei vorliegen hat mus man nur noch logisch schlussfolgern. Also fehlende Infos hier liefern oder es eben selbst machen.